Why did the customer contact us?

The customer experienced a roof leak that resulted in water damage to the closet, specifically affecting the drywall ceiling, the carpeted flooring, and the insulation in the attic space above.

Solutions provided:

Technicians performed a thorough walkthrough and Water Services Agreement (WSA) to assess the damage. The team removed all saturated blown-in insulation from the attic to prevent further moisture migration. To stabilize the environment, industrial drying equipment was deployed to target the attic framing and sheathing, the closet's drywall ceiling, and the carpet. The team also provided a clear communication plan, updating the client on the mitigation progress and scheduling a return visit for monitoring and equipment removal.
